Thanks man.

I dont mind as he could have been on a dyno that shows high numbers and he also could have been on c16 or q16. There are so many other variables also but Dynojets are the best dyno's to use to get the true whp numbers. My buddy/tuner said I could have easily made 650 whp on 24-25 psi if it was on c16, q16 or even e85. We were limited with the 110 race fuel on the timing to keep it safe and so we had to put a little more boost to it to get to 650 whp.
